本公開涉及測量領(lǐng)域,尤其涉及一種機(jī)器人焊接調(diào)整方法、裝置、系統(tǒng)。
背景技術(shù):
1、在焊接機(jī)器人的工作過程中,由于上道工序來料一致性差、工裝夾具設(shè)計有誤差等原因,會導(dǎo)致工件焊縫有位置偏移、變形等問題,機(jī)器人無法直接通過示教回放的方式直接進(jìn)行焊接,需要先通過傳感器對焊縫進(jìn)行測量、尋位,然后對焊接軌跡進(jìn)行糾偏之后,才能正常進(jìn)行焊接工作過程。在焊接過程中,因?yàn)榇嬖诠ぜ軣嶙冃蔚葐栴},往往還需要對焊縫進(jìn)行實(shí)時跟蹤,根據(jù)焊縫的實(shí)際位置動態(tài)修正焊接軌跡,以保證最終的焊接效果。
2、傳統(tǒng)的解決方案是在焊接前使用焊絲機(jī)械接觸尋位、點(diǎn)激光傳感器尋位、線激光傳感器尋位、3d視覺尋位等方法,對焊縫進(jìn)行測量和修正,或者在焊接過程中使用實(shí)時跟蹤,調(diào)整焊槍的軌跡滿足焊接要求。但是現(xiàn)有這些尋位、跟蹤方式存在以下幾個缺點(diǎn):
3、1.焊接前提前尋位測量焊縫,精度依賴于機(jī)器人本身精度和相機(jī)精度,機(jī)器人長期工作后由于關(guān)節(jié)磨損,整體精度會有所下降;
4、2.焊接過程中工件受熱發(fā)生形變,提前采集的焊縫形狀已經(jīng)無法使用;
5、3.目前主要實(shí)時跟蹤焊縫中心位置,機(jī)器人焊接過程中一般都會采用擺焊的方式,相機(jī)跟隨一起擺動導(dǎo)致識別不穩(wěn)定;
6、4.由于焊縫寬度受熱會變化,只跟蹤焊縫中心位置也不能滿足焊接需求,需要根據(jù)實(shí)際情況實(shí)時調(diào)整焊接速度、焊接電流、擺動幅度等焊接參數(shù)。
7、因此,當(dāng)前焊縫測量尋位技術(shù)精度不可靠的問題有待解決。
技術(shù)實(shí)現(xiàn)思路
1、本公開正是為了解決上述課題而完成,其目的在于提供一種自動調(diào)整機(jī)器人焊接過程中產(chǎn)生的偏差,提高焊縫的合格率的機(jī)器人焊接調(diào)整方法、裝置、系統(tǒng)。
2、本公開提供該
技術(shù)實(shí)現(xiàn)要素:
部分以便以簡要的形式介紹構(gòu)思,這些構(gòu)思將在后面的具體實(shí)施方式部分被詳細(xì)描述。該發(fā)明內(nèi)容部分并不旨在標(biāo)識要求保護(hù)的技術(shù)方案的關(guān)鍵特征或必要特征,也不旨在用于限制所要求的保護(hù)的技術(shù)方案的范圍。
3、為了解決上述技術(shù)問題,本公開實(shí)施例還提供一種機(jī)器人焊接調(diào)整方法,采用了如下所述的技術(shù)方案,包括:
4、獲取熔池狀態(tài)信息,根據(jù)所述熔池狀態(tài)信息確定焊接參數(shù)調(diào)整信息;
5、對所述焊接參數(shù)調(diào)整信息進(jìn)行預(yù)設(shè)處理;
6、根據(jù)預(yù)設(shè)處理后的所述焊接參數(shù)調(diào)整信息計算所述機(jī)器人的末端位置姿態(tài)調(diào)整信息;
7、根據(jù)所述末端位置姿態(tài)調(diào)整信息調(diào)整所述機(jī)器人的焊接軌跡。
8、為了解決上述技術(shù)問題,本公開實(shí)施例還提供一種機(jī)器人焊接調(diào)整裝置,采用了如下所述的技術(shù)方案,包括:
9、參數(shù)調(diào)整信息確定模塊,獲取熔池狀態(tài)信息,根據(jù)所述熔池狀態(tài)信息確定焊接參數(shù)調(diào)整信息;
10、參數(shù)調(diào)整信息處理模塊,對所述焊接參數(shù)調(diào)整信息進(jìn)行預(yù)設(shè)處理;
11、姿態(tài)調(diào)整信息獲取模塊,根據(jù)預(yù)設(shè)處理后的所述焊接參數(shù)調(diào)整信息獲取所述機(jī)器人的末端位置姿態(tài)調(diào)整信息;
12、焊接軌跡調(diào)整模塊,根據(jù)所述末端位置姿態(tài)調(diào)整信息調(diào)整所述機(jī)器人的焊接軌跡。
13、為了解決上述技術(shù)問題,本公開實(shí)施例還提供一種機(jī)器人焊接調(diào)整系統(tǒng),采用了如下所述的技術(shù)方案,包括:
14、如前所述的機(jī)器人焊接調(diào)整裝置;
15、機(jī)器人,用于根據(jù)所述機(jī)器人焊接調(diào)整裝置的指示對末端位置姿態(tài)進(jìn)行調(diào)整;
16、熔池相機(jī),設(shè)置于所述機(jī)器人的末端或獨(dú)立設(shè)置,用于獲取所述熔池狀態(tài)信息。
17、為了解決上述技術(shù)問題,本公開實(shí)施例還提供一種計算機(jī)設(shè)備,采用了如下所述的技術(shù)方案,包括:存儲器和處理器,所述存儲器中存儲有計算機(jī)程序,所述處理器執(zhí)行所述計算機(jī)程序時實(shí)現(xiàn)如前任一項(xiàng)所述的方法。
18、為了解決上述技術(shù)問題,本公開實(shí)施例還提供一種計算機(jī)可讀存儲介質(zhì),采用了如下所述的技術(shù)方案,包括:所述計算機(jī)可讀存儲介質(zhì)上存儲有計算機(jī)程序,所述計算機(jī)程序被處理器執(zhí)行時實(shí)現(xiàn)如前任一項(xiàng)所述的方法。
19、根據(jù)本公開所公開的技術(shù)方案,與現(xiàn)有技術(shù)相比,其主要特點(diǎn)是,自動調(diào)整機(jī)器人焊接過程中產(chǎn)生的偏差,提高焊縫的合格率,簡單、高效,提升了用戶體驗(yàn)。
1.一種機(jī)器人焊接調(diào)整方法,其特征在于,包括:
2.如權(quán)利要求1所述的機(jī)器人焊接調(diào)整方法,其特征在于,所述根據(jù)預(yù)設(shè)處理后的所述焊接參數(shù)調(diào)整信息計算所述機(jī)器人的末端位置姿態(tài)調(diào)整信息,包括,
3.如權(quán)利要求2所述的機(jī)器人焊接調(diào)整方法,其特征在于,還包括,
4.如權(quán)利要求3所述的機(jī)器人焊接調(diào)整方法,其特征在于,
5.如權(quán)利要求1所述的機(jī)器人焊接調(diào)整方法,其特征在于,還包括,
6.如權(quán)利要求5所述的機(jī)器人焊接調(diào)整方法,其特征在于,
7.一種機(jī)器人焊接調(diào)整裝置,其特征在于,實(shí)現(xiàn)如權(quán)利要求1-6任一項(xiàng)所述的方法,包括:
8.一種機(jī)器人焊接調(diào)整系統(tǒng),其特征在于,包括:
9.一種計算機(jī)設(shè)備,包括存儲器和處理器,所述存儲器中存儲有計算機(jī)程序,所述處理器執(zhí)行所述計算機(jī)程序時實(shí)現(xiàn)如權(quán)利要求1-6中任一項(xiàng)所述的方法。
10.一種計算機(jī)可讀存儲介質(zhì),其特征在于,所述計算機(jī)可讀存儲介質(zhì)上存儲有計算機(jī)程序,所述計算機(jī)程序被處理器執(zhí)行時實(shí)現(xiàn)如權(quán)利要求1-6中任一項(xiàng)所述的方法。